The Bakery House

Located at 604 W Lancaster Ave, Bryn Mawr, PA 19010, The Bakery House is a premier bakery destination known for its exceptional selection of baked goods, cakes, cookies, pastries, pies, and wedding cakes. With a phone number of 05254139 and a website at thebakeryhouse.net, customers can easily reach out or visit to explore their offerings.

The bakery specializes in a range of products, including not only standard items but also unique and custom options. Whether you're looking for a simple pastry for breakfast or a intricately designed wedding cake, The Bakery House has you covered.

In addition to their impressive selection, The Bakery House offers other conveniences such as delivery, in-store pickup, takeout, and wheelchair accessible parking lot. They also provide coffee, breakfast, and the option for a quick visit. Customers can pay using various methods including credit cards, debit cards, and NFC mobile payments.

With an impressive average rating of 4.4/5 based on 195 reviews on Google My Business, it's clear that The Bakery House is a beloved local bakery.
